TotalFinaElf plans to operate over drilling on Caspian sea
/IRBIS, Dec.6, 00/ - REUTERS informed that TotalFinaElf, French oil company that supports Kazakhstan-Turkmenistan-Iran pipe-line project plans to become main drilling operator of OKIOC consortium on the Northern part of Caspian Sea.
The representatives of the company claimed that discovery of Kashagan oil field was one of the major event in the oil world for last thirty years. He also noted that it will be biggest adventure of the twenty first century.
It was reported that the company has all production and financial facilities to become major drilling operator.
Other candidates for the project are ExxonMobil and Shell.
The Kashagan field could become the biggest oil reserve in the world. The evaluation drilling did not yet give exact estimates, whereas Kazakhstan government already announced the preliminary figure of 7 bln tons.
The government reported that preliminary voting will be held in mid December, while final selection in January of 2001. That time, OKIOC participants would select from two candidates that took major part of votes in December. The company should collect 70% of votes to become the operator.
TotalFinaElf still insists that the Southern direction of oil transporting is most profitable.
At present, TotalFinaElf has about $1 bln in Kazakhstan.
